Resolution Minerals Ltd (ASX:RML) has entered the spotlight following a notable development tied to its Antimony Ridge project in Idaho, United States.
The project has been granted FAST-41 Permitting Transparency Program status, a move that signals stronger alignment with national priorities in critical minerals. This development has added a new layer of visibility to the company’s exploration and development pathway while reinforcing the strategic importance of antimony within global markets.
Understanding FAST-41 and Its Importance
What is FAST-41?
The FAST-41 initiative is a US government-backed program designed to improve transparency, coordination, and efficiency in the permitting process for infrastructure and resource projects. Projects included under this framework benefit from a more structured and streamlined regulatory pathway.
For Resolution Minerals Ltd (RML), inclusion in this program represents more than administrative convenience. It reflects recognition at a federal level that the Antimony Ridge project holds strategic value.
Why It Matters
Projects under FAST-41 receive enhanced coordination among federal agencies, which can reduce uncertainties often associated with approvals. This clarity is especially critical in the mining sector, where regulatory timelines can significantly influence development progress.
By entering this program, Antimony Ridge joins a select group of projects that are viewed as nationally significant. This designation supports smoother communication between stakeholders and may help maintain steady momentum as the project advances.
Antimony: A Critical Mineral in Focus
Rising Global Relevance
Antimony has emerged as a crucial material across several industries. It is widely used in flame retardants, which are essential in construction, electronics, and textiles. Beyond civilian applications, antimony plays a key role in defence-related uses, including munitions and other specialised equipment.
As geopolitical dynamics shift and supply chains face pressure, countries like the United States are placing greater emphasis on securing domestic sources of critical minerals.
